renew

Definition

  • verb: to make (something) new, fresh, or strong again
  • verb: to make like new
  • synonyms: recommence, repeat, regenerate

Examples

  • If you haven't listened to this music since the 1960s, it's time to 'renew your acquaintance' with these songs.

  • She 'renewed' the library book. [=she had the library extend the period of time that she can borrow the book]

  • At the start of each school year, we 'renew' our commitment to helping students succeed.
